// SPDX-License-Identifier: LGPL-2.1+
#ifndef __NM_L3_CONFIG_DATA_H__
#define __NM_L3_CONFIG_DATA_H__
#include "nm-glib-aux/nm-dedup-multi.h"
#include "nm-setting-connection.h"
#include "nm-setting-ip6-config.h"
#include "platform/nm-platform.h"
typedef enum {
NM_L3_CONFIG_DAT_FLAGS_NONE = 0,
/* if set, then the merge flag NM_L3_CONFIG_MERGE_FLAGS_NO_DEFAULT_ROUTES gets
* ignored during merge. */
NM_L3_CONFIG_DAT_FLAGS_IGNORE_MERGE_NO_DEFAULT_ROUTES = (1ull << 0),
} NML3ConfigDatFlags;
typedef struct _NML3ConfigData NML3ConfigData;
NML3ConfigData *nm_l3_config_data_new (NMDedupMultiIndex *multi_idx,
int ifindex);
const NML3ConfigData *nm_l3_config_data_ref (const NML3ConfigData *self);
const NML3ConfigData *nm_l3_config_data_ref_and_seal (const NML3ConfigData *self);
const NML3ConfigData *nm_l3_config_data_seal (const NML3ConfigData *self);
void nm_l3_config_data_unref (const NML3ConfigData *self);
NM_AUTO_DEFINE_FCN0 (const NML3ConfigData *, _nm_auto_unref_l3cfg, nm_l3_config_data_unref);
#define nm_auto_unref_l3cfg nm_auto (_nm_auto_unref_l3cfg)
NM_AUTO_DEFINE_FCN0 (NML3ConfigData *, _nm_auto_unref_l3cfg_init, nm_l3_config_data_unref);
#define nm_auto_unref_l3cfg_init nm_auto (_nm_auto_unref_l3cfg_init)
gboolean nm_l3_config_data_is_sealed (const NML3ConfigData *self);
NML3ConfigData *nm_l3_config_data_new_clone (const NML3ConfigData *src,
int ifindex);
NML3ConfigData *nm_l3_config_data_new_from_connection (NMDedupMultiIndex *multi_idx,
int ifindex,
NMConnection *connection,
NMSettingConnectionMdns mdns,
NMSettingConnectionLlmnr llmnr,
guint32 route_table,
guint32 route_metric);
NML3ConfigData *nm_l3_config_data_new_from_platform (NMDedupMultiIndex *multi_idx,
int ifindex,
NMPlatform *platform,
NMSettingIP6ConfigPrivacy ipv6_privacy_rfc4941);
